Frequently asked questions about Moat Village Centre

What does Moat Village Centre do?

Provision of meeting places. Hire of village hall. Public use for elections. Annual BBQ, Family Christmas Party. Easter Children's Event. Pilates Exercise Classes. Singing For All Group. Weekly Art class, monthly clubs

How much income did Moat Village Centre report in 2023?

Moat Village Centre reported total income of £19k and reported expenditure of £3k for the financial year ending 2023, based on the most recent annual return filed with the Charity Commission.

When was Moat Village Centre registered as a charity?

Moat Village Centre was registered with the Charity Commission for England and Wales on 8 December 1964 as charity number 226690. It has been registered for 62 years.

Who runs Moat Village Centre?

Moat Village Centre is governed by a board of 10 trustees. The chair of trustees is William Armstrong. Trustees are legally responsible for the charity's governance and are listed in full on its profile.

Where does Moat Village Centre operate?

Moat Village Centre operates in Cumbria, as recorded in its Charity Commission filing.

Is Moat Village Centre a registered charity?

Yes — Moat Village Centre is a registered charity in England and Wales, charity number 226690.
